Book Description

As evidence grows of the hugely damaging effect that the destruction of the world’s forests is having, with global warming an ever-present threat, The Forest Fights Back looks at man’s unquenchable search for resources, notes his greed and readiness to bribe and corrupt, and asks the question: “What if the creatures who live in these irreplaceable ecosystems were to get together and fight for their survival?” Is such a thing possible?”


A grandfather, prompted by his grandson Joe, attempts to find the answer to this question with some surprising results.

 

The author spent three years living in and around the jungles of Southeast Asia. There, he first encountered the unique tropical rainforests and witnessed their destruction at the hands of the logging industry. Despite working in other areas of the world, he remained haunted by the destruction he had seen. His decision to write about this experience led to The Forest Fights Back.
